The color selector is equipment for automatically sorting out heterochromatic particles in particle materials by utilizing a photoelectric detection technology according to the difference of optical characteristics of the materials. The method is widely applied to the industries of grain, food, pigment chemical industry and the like, and has very obvious separation effect on malignant impurities and special materials such as regenerated plastic sheets with high separation difficulty, plastic particles, corns, various beans, various rice, ores, hot peppers, pepper, garlic rice, melon seeds, raisins, seeds, traditional Chinese medicines, sea cucumbers, dried shrimps, clove fish, glass, metal, homochromy rods and the like.

Detailed Description
The present invention will be described in further detail with reference to the following examples and drawings, but the embodiments of the present invention are not limited thereto.
Referring to fig. 1, a crawler-type color sorting device for traditional Chinese medicine processing is arranged below a finished product cavity, and the process of conveying materials to the color sorting device can refer to a high-quality coarse cereal color sorting machine disclosed in chinese patent application No. CN 209753458U. This crawler-type look selection device for traditional chinese medicine processing includes conveying table 1, and conveying table 1's direction of transfer is conveying table 1's length direction, and conveying table 1's length direction is the level setting. The conveying table 1 comprises a first conveying belt 11 and a first flange 12, a roller 13 is arranged on a rotating frame above the conveying table 1, and a driving piece used for driving the roller 13 to rotate is further arranged on the conveying table 1. Conveying 1 conveying terminal below is provided with letter sorting platform 2, and letter sorting platform 2 includes second conveyer belt 21 and second flange 22, and the fluorescent tube 25 has been erect to letter sorting platform 2 top.
In the work, the discharge gate is ceaselessly carried the material to conveying platform 1, and the material removes along conveying platform 1's direction of transfer with the help of first conveyer belt 11 on conveying platform 1, and when the material passed through roller bearing 13 below, the material was opened out under the combined action of roller bearing 13 and first conveyer belt 11, and the material that opens out continues to remove to sorting platform 2 along conveying platform 1's direction of transfer, and the staff sorts the material of opening out in 2 both sides of sorting platform.
Referring to fig. 2, the length direction of the first rib 12 is parallel to the length direction of the conveying table 1, the first rib 12 is horizontally perpendicular to the upper surface of the conveying table 1 on the conveying table 1, and one first rib 12 is arranged on the conveying table 1 along both sides of the conveying table 1 in the width direction. One side of any first rib 12 close to the first conveyor belt 11 is fixedly provided with a first soft pad 14, the length direction of the first soft pad 14 is parallel to the conveying direction of the conveying table 1, and the lower side of any first soft pad 14 is lapped on the upper surface of the first conveyor belt 11. Two ends of the roller 13 are rotatably erected on the two first flanges 12 respectively, and the axial direction of the roller 13 is perpendicular to the conveying direction of the conveying table 1. The rolling shafts 13 are arranged on the conveying table 1 along the conveying direction of the conveying table 1, any two adjacent rolling shafts 13 are in contact with each other, and the heights of any rolling shaft 13 are sequentially reduced in a step shape along the conveying direction of the conveying table 1. The driving part is a driving motor 15, the driving motor 15 is fixed on one side of any first rib 12 far away from the first conveyor belt 11, and the driving motor 15 is coaxially connected with one end of the bottommost roller 13.
In operation, the discharge gate is incessantly carried the material to conveying platform 1, and the material removes along conveying platform 1's direction of transfer with the help of first conveyer belt 11 on conveying platform 1, and when the material passed through roller 13 below, the material was opened out under the combined action of a plurality of roller 13 and first conveyer belt 11, and the material that opens out continues to remove to letter sorting platform 2 along conveying platform 1's direction of transfer.
Referring to fig. 3, the starting end of the sorting table 2 is located below the end of the conveying table 1, the conveying direction of the sorting table 2 is parallel to the conveying direction of the conveying table 1, the length direction of the sorting table 2 is parallel to the conveying direction of the sorting table 2, and the length direction of the sorting table 2 is horizontally arranged. The length direction of second flange 22 is on a parallel with the length direction of letter sorting platform 2, and second flange 22 is on letter sorting platform 2 the level perpendicular to letter sorting bench upper surface, and second flange 22 all is provided with one along letter sorting platform 2 width direction both sides on letter sorting platform 2. One side of any one second flange 22 close to the second conveyor belt 21 is fixedly provided with a second soft cushion 23, the length direction of any one second soft cushion 23 is parallel to the conveying direction of the sorting table 2, and the lower side of any one second soft cushion 23 is lapped on the upper surface of the second conveyor belt 21.
In operation, the material that spreads out drops to letter sorting platform 2 from conveying platform 1, makes the material more dispersed on letter sorting platform 2. The second cushion 23 fixed to the second apron 22 covers the gap between the second conveyor belt 21 and the second apron 22, preventing the material from falling through the gap between the second conveyor belt 21 and the second apron.
Sorting table 2 erects and is equipped with lighting fixture 24, fixedly on lighting fixture 24 being provided with fluorescent tube 25, and the length direction of fluorescent tube 25 is on a parallel with sorting table 2's length direction, and just one side that arbitrary second flange 22 is close to second conveyer belt 21 all fixedly is provided with LED lamp 26, and the length direction of arbitrary LED lamp 26 all is on a parallel with sorting table 2's length direction. The conveying end of the sorting table 2 is provided with a guide plate 27, the guide plate 27 is horizontally vertical to the upper surface of the sorting table 2 on the sorting table 2, and the guide plate 27 is provided with two pieces at the conveying end of the sorting table 2. One end of two guide plates 27 is fixed respectively in one side that two second flanges 22 are close to second conveyer belt 21, and the opposite side of two guide plates 27 all inclines to sorting platform 2 middle part along the direction of transfer of sorting platform 2, and is formed with feed opening 28 between two guide plates 27, and the downside of two guide plates 27 all with second conveyer belt 21 upper surface butt.
In the work, the staff sorts the material of dispersion in the both sides of letter sorting platform 2, and the staff can be fast accurate with the help of the light of fluorescent tube 25 and LED lamp 26 sort out unqualified material. The remaining material is moved by means of the second conveyor belt 21 in the conveying direction of the sorting table 2 and is guided by the guide plate 27 to the feed opening 28, where the material is collected by the staff.
The implementation principle of the above embodiment is as follows: in operation, the finished product chamber is constantly carried the material to conveying table 1, and the material removes on conveying table 1 with the help of first conveyer belt 11 along conveying table 1's direction of transfer, and when the material passed through roller 13 below, the material was spread out under the combined action of a plurality of roller 13 and first conveyer belt 11. The material that spreads out continues to move along the direction of transfer of conveying platform 1 and drops to letter sorting platform 2, and the material that drops on letter sorting platform 2 is more dispersed. The staff sorts the material of dispersion in the both sides of letter sorting platform 2, and the staff can be fast accurate with the help of the light of fluorescent tube 25 and LED lamp 26 sort out unqualified material. The remaining material is moved by means of the second conveyor belt 21 in the conveying direction of the sorting table 2 and is guided by the guide plate 27 to the feed opening 28, where the material is collected by the staff.
